In the Pinned section, you’ll see a list of apps that are designated to the Start menu.
But the Pinned section will, by default, only show you a list of mostly Microsoft apps.
Right-click any app in thePinnedsection and choose the Unpin from Start option.
Go to theAll Apps section, right-click any app you want to pin, and choose Pin to Start.
after you snag pinned everything you want, drag and drop to rearrange the apps however youd like.
Thankfully, Microsoft has made removing this bloatware easy.
Go to Pinned section and right-click any app that you want to uninstall.
ChooseUninstallfrom the context menu, and then clickUninstallagain from the popup.
Repeat this for all unwanted apps.
This section will show you recent files, new apps, and app suggestions.
But its not always on point.
Theres no way to remove this section entirely, but you could at least make it less prominent.
Go toSettings>Personalization>Startand disable Show recently opened items in Start, Jump Lists and File Explorer.

Put the Start menu back on the left
Its not just the Start menu design thats new.
Its the placement as well.
Go toSettings>Personalization>Taskbar>Taskbar Behaviors.
Here, from the Taskbar alignment option, switch to Left.
